Renovation in Batumi’s Old Housing Stock: Budget, Timelines, Key Risks

Renovating old buildings in Batumi: what to expect 🏚️➡️🏡

Renovating in Batumi’s older residential stock is different from working on new developments. You may face outdated wiring, aging plumbing, uneven floors, and hidden structural issues. This guide gives a realistic workflow to plan budget, set timelines, and avoid common pitfalls.

Key differences from new construction 🔍

  • Older walls and ceilings may hide surprises: cracks, damp, or weak mortar.
  • Electrical and plumbing systems often need updating to current standards.
  • Original layouts can be charming but may require structural work for modern living.

First steps: inspect and plan 📝

  1. Arrange a professional inspection to check load-bearing elements, moisture, electrical systems, and pipes.
  2. Prioritize tasks: safety and systems first, then structure, then finishes.
  3. Decide which original elements you want to keep for character and which to replace.

Budgeting smartly 💰

  • Split your budget into three parts: diagnostics and prep, structural/utility work, and finishing touches. Include a contingency reserve — surprises are common in older properties.
  • Think about long-term value: investing in new wiring, insulation, and quality waterproofing increases comfort and resale appeal.
  • If you intend to rent or sell, factor in costs for permits and professional staging.

A minimal refresh covers surface finishes and minor repairs; a full renovation includes redoing utilities and re-planning spaces.

Timelines: realistic expectations ⏳

Timelines depend on scope and contractor availability. Small updates may take a few weeks, while a full renovation can span several weeks to months. Always build in a buffer for delays and permit approvals.

Main risks and mitigation strategies ⚠️

  • Hidden defects (damp, rot, cracks): reduce risk with thorough pre-work inspections.
  • Electrical hazards: replace old wiring and fit modern protection (RCDs, circuit breakers).
  • Plumbing failures: check vertical risers and sewer lines before finishing.
  • Unauthorized changes: check local regulations and obtain permits to avoid fines or future resale problems.
  • Low-quality contractors: choose teams with references, written quotes, and clear contracts.

Choosing a contractor and managing the project 👷‍♀️👷‍♂️

  • Ask for portfolios and client references; visit past projects if possible.
  • Request a detailed estimate and phased schedule.
  • Sign a contract specifying scope, milestones, payments, and acceptance criteria.
  • Inspect work regularly and document progress with photos.

Practical tips and small wins 🛠️

  • Fix systems (electric, plumbing, insulation) before doing final finishes.
  • Consider insulation and soundproofing for comfort and added value.
  • Preserve quality historic features where possible — they can become selling points.
  • Buy materials early and allow for lead times.

Example phased plan (guide)

  1. Inspection and estimate.
  2. Demolition and removal of old finishes; replace major systems.
  3. Structural and rough-in works: walls, floors, wiring, pipes.
  4. Finishing works: plaster, paint, flooring, fixtures.
  5. Final inspection and small corrections.

Final thoughts — balance risk and opportunity ✅

Renovating in Batumi’s older buildings takes extra attention, but it also offers the chance to create a unique home with character. Plan conservatively, keep a contingency budget, and hire reliable professionals.
